The college is renowned for its strong industry connections and a robust alumni network, which bolster its placement reputation, especially in Maharashtra. Despite a slight decline in placements in 2023 due to an economic downturn, the campus remains a popular destination for numerous IT companies. Students without backlogs and with a CGPA of 7 or higher are typically eligible for most placement opportunities. Impressively, a student independently secured an 80 Lakh package at Google, as Google did not participate in campus placements.
Major companies like Capgemini, TCS, Wipro, Amazon, Microsoft, and Schneider Electric regularly offer internships. The college is noted for its success in both core and IT placements and offers significant research opportunities. Located in Nagpur, it has the highest fee structure among local institutions due to its autonomous status, but it offsets costs with financial assistance through industry partnerships, offering scholarships to students in need. For instance, N.K Gark, a Nagpur-based industry, awards scholarships of 50,000 INR annually.
Additionally, hostel accommodation costs 85,000 INR per year. The college further supports students by providing access to government and non-government scholarship programs and maintains an on-campus bank that offers education loans to financially needy students.
